body {
	font-size:14px;
    font-family:"Lucida Grande", "Hiragino Kaku Gothic Pro", "ヒラギノ角ゴ Pro W3", Geneva, Arial, Verdana, sans-serif;
	line-height:1.231;
}
* html body {
    font-family:"ＭＳ Ｐゴシック",sans-serif;
}
*:first-child+html body {
    font-family:'メイリオ', Meiryo,"ＭＳ Ｐゴシック",sans-serif;
}
html>/**/body {
    font-family:'メイリオ', Meiryo,"ＭＳ Ｐゴシック",sans-serif;
}


.s{font-size:12px;}
.n{font-size:14px;}
.b{font-size:17px;}

.l{line-height:1.231 !important;}
.lm{line-height:1.5 !important;}
.lh{line-height:1.8 !important;}
.inum {ime-mode:disabled;}
.ijp {ime-mode:active;}
.ieng {ime-mode:inactive;}
.eng {font-family:Helvetica, Arial, Tahoma, sans-serif;}

/* モダンブラウザ */
html>/**/body .s{
    font-size:12px !important;
}
html>/**/body .n{
    font-size:14px !important;
}
html>/**/body .b{
    font-size:17px !important;
}
#headerArea li#btn-large a {
	background-position:left -20px;
}
#headerArea li#btn-middle a {
	background-position:left top;
}